As human beings, we have a goal, and it's up to us to achieve it. That's our purpose, our reason for being. In fact, purpose always precedes product.
Each of us feels obliged to find our own raison d'être. It's something rooted in human nature that tells us we're here for a purpose.
I'm talking about the purpose of our life, which must precede life itself, and life is the result of this purpose. It's not something we can create after we're born.
Speaking of purpose, we understand that purpose comes before fact. You don't build a car until you know what it's for. When you need to get quickly from where you are to where you want to go, you invent a car - the purpose always precedes the product.
